The advantage of Bushido is that you can chug potions without having to disarm a shield. And you have some useful Bushido spells.
The advantage of Parry is that you can use nifty shields for extra bonuses. And you have room for one more skill.

The chance to block is nearly the same with both skills.

Parry: Blocking with shield
Parry + Bushido: Blocking without a shield (penalty if you use a shield)

With a two-handed weapon and NO Bushido skill you cannot block any attacks. You'd have to rely on weapon skill and Defense Chance Increase only (both reduce the chance to be hit). If you want to use two-handed weapons and want to be able to block, you need Parry AND Bushido, since you cannot use any shields.

That isn't entirely accurate.

If you have high bushido, and you equip a sheild, your chance to parry is reduced to roughly 5%.

If you have just 120 parry, at least 80 dexterity you have the best chance to parry while holding a shield (35%). If you don't want to wear a shield, you can still parry but the chance is reduced down to 20%.

Honor only gives you the extra damage and stamina/mana bonus on a kill if you have the bushido skill.

But you can do without focus anyway. Having mana/stamina leech on your weapon will help with that.
